Two Chinese were charged with being in possession of $120 worth of prepared Macao oplum, which was traced by the police from the very moment that it left the steamer Chuenchow. The younger of the two defendants was arrest- ed at Sai Woo Street by Revenue Officers, and, pleading that he was only a carrier, he took the officers to the steamer, where the second defendant was pointed out as be ing the actual smuggler.
